Abstract
A comparative estimation of the effectiveness of hemostasis by means of ligation of the internal iliac arteries and roentgen-endovascular occlusion of these vessels was carried out in 30 patients with a bleeding carcinoma of the urinary bladder and prostate growing into its wall. For the occlusion of the internal iliac artery metallic spirals were used in 15 patients, in 4 of them they were used in combination with a gelatine sponge. The roentgen-endovascular occlusion is thought by the authors to be the method of choice.Entities:
